An owl who is afraid of flying outside in big open spaces has been given his own red brick house. Gandalf the great grey owl gets scared flying out in the open so his owners have built his aviary inside a brick shed. He now spends his days watching the world go by out of his window. “He is a bit of a wuss as he doesn’t like flying in big open spaces,” said owner Janet Southard, who runs the Wild Arena photography company, based inside Knowsley Safari Park near Liverpool.  Picture: Mark Bridger / Rex Features
